Worried about early aging and wrinkles which may appear anytime? Worry no more. Have vibrant self-confidence with the following well balanced meals that help avoid wrinkles:

Select food items which improve collagen

Collagen is vital protein in your skin that’s accountable for maintaining it healthy and youthful by supporting and also connecting skin tissues, and also muscle, blood vessel, and scar cells. As you become older, your skin begins to get drier and inelastic as collagen production decreases, resulting in the formation of wrinkles and the sagging of your skin. To help avoid wrinkles, you should pick foods abundant in certain vitamins which improve your body’s collagen.

* Vit. C. Vitamin C aids produce collagen and helps in the growth and restoration of body cells, including the skin. Certain foods abundant in Vitamin C involve oranges, guava, winter squash, kiwi, spinach, and also berries.

* Vitamin B3. Vitamin B3 or Niacin is known to help augment the production of collagen in your body, among its other health advantages. Vitamin B3 may be present in red meat, liver, tuna fish, as well as nuts.

Eat foods full of antioxidants

Free radicals in the body ruin healthy skin tissues and wear down collagen in the skin, causing you to age and wrinkle faster. Consuming meals full of antioxidants can help ruin these free radicals and promote healthier, more youthful looking skin. Foods full of anti-oxidants include berries including blueberries, strawberries, along with blackberries, along with artichokes, beans, spinach, potatoes, apples, carrots, and dark chocolate. Foods full of copper, like lobster, crabs, oysters, nuts, soybeans, as well as enriched cereals are also rich in anti-oxidants.

Incorporate Omega-3 fatty acids in your intake of food

Omega 3-fatty acids are claimed to cure irritation on the skin that often triggers scaly dry skin and also wrinkles. Adding omega-3 fatty acid-rich food in what you eat will aid stop wrinkles, and also dry skin, pimples, and redness. Examples of these foods involve fish, sardines, and also flax seeds and nuts if you don’t like fish.

Eat lycopene-rich food items

Another cause of wrinkles and early aging include frequent exposure to sunlight and sunburn. Studies have shown that daily consumption of lycopene-rich foods really result in less sunburn and much better skin defense against the sun’s harmful rays. Lycopene-rich foods include tomatoes, watermelon, cantaloupe, mangoes, sweet potatoes, as well as green spinach.
